Guernsey 07 - St Peter Port Film Noir Photoshoot

Week two of our Guernsey holiday Sue and I were joined by 9 other people from the Cambridge Camera Club. Ann Miles was running a Photo Workshop, with Ian Wilson, for the Guernsey Photo Clubs. The idea was that met up and had some photographic fun.

Carl, from one of the Island Clubs organised 5 models to meet us in St Peter Port. Ann's idea was to try and recreate Film Noir style photos, Blocked out blacks, burnt out highlights and reminiscent of some of the great 1940's / 50's black and white films with gangsters etc.

The models had not done this before and neither had most of us, so we were all outside our photographic comfort zone.
